History

Faith Today

   Faith Presbyterian Church continues its ministry in its very visible downtown location.  Since 2004, the average worship attendance has grown 73 %, while membership has risen by 28%, making Faith Presbyterian Church one of the fastest growing churches in the Cherokee Presbytery. As in the beginning, the congregation is actively involved in the church and its ministries, many of which have been in place since the inception of the church. The congregation’s commitment to the work of the Lord through serving people was established by the founders and continues today.  Faith Presbyterian has one of the most dedicated and active congregations in the area and continues to support a variety of local, national, and international ministries with their time, talents, and money.  A complete list of ministries and activities is too long to include in this writing. An abbreviated list of local ministries and activities includes: Feed Fannin, Snack in a Backpack, Food Pantry, Fannin Christian Learning Center, Fannin County Family Connection, Open Arms of Blue Ridge, Good Samaritans Labor Day Bar-B-Q and Thanksgiving Open Table, Casting for Recovery, Faithful Knitters, East Fannin Elementary School socks, underwear and t-shirt collection, FDA Seamless Summer feeding program for children,  Bowls of Hope,  Habitat for Humanity, North Georgia Crisis Center, and Heritage Care Center, and tutoring students at Blue Ridge Elementary School. Faith Today 

 

Dr. Jim Simpson, Pastor

I was born in Hamilton, Scotland and lived in Motherwell, my home town, all the way through High School. Throughout this time I was continually encouraged by my parents in my faith and active participation in our local Church of Scotland congregation, St. Margaret’s. I regard myself as a “child of the church,” having never doubted God’s existence and presence in the world and the lives of people around me. I am a Well supporter and some say my blood is claret and amber! 

The year after leaving High School I spent as a Training in Evangelism volunteer at the St. Ninian’s Centre in Crieff. I graduated from the University of Dundee with a Bachelor of Science degree in 1983 during that time I was accepted as a candidate for the Ministry of the Church of Scotland and became a candidate of the Presbytery of Hamilton before transferring to the Presbytery of Aberdeen, by whom I was licensed as a Preacher of the Gospel in June of 1986. That same year I graduated from the University of Aberdeen with my Bachelor of Divinity with Honors in Systematic Theology and Church History. 

In 1983, Janice, my wife, and I were married. We have two children; Jennifer is married to Ryan and she is currently a stay at home mom with our two grandchildren, Kayleigh and Callum. Our son, works for Sojourners in Washington DC.  

Arriving in the United Sates in 1996, I continued my theological education, graduating with my D.Min. from Columbia Theological Seminary in Decatur, GA in 2000.  

My probationary year was spend at Bellshill West Parish and I was ordained to the ministry of Word and Sacrament by the Presbytery of Kincardine and Deeside on May 7, 1987, and inducted as Parish Minister in Newtonhill (Bourtreebush) and Portlethen Churches, near Aberdeen. I served there until accepting the call to serve the Northminster Presbyterian Church in Roswell GA in 1996. Between 2007 and 2009 I served as Director of Church Relations at Presbyterian College. I served as the Pastor and Head of Staff of Oakland Avenue Presbyterian Church in Rock Hill SC from 2009 to 2013 until moving to Blue Ridge GA to serve as Pastor of Faith Presbyterian Church in January of 2013. I am a minister member of Cherokee Presbytery. 

My hobbies and interests include lots of sports, football, rugby and golf. I enjoy watching movies, traveling and good food and company. 

The Rev. Susan Haynes, Pastoral Associate

 Before attending seminary, Susan held various positions in the business world, including owning and running a small business. 


Prior to becoming a Teaching Elder, she served as a Deacon (ordained at Stockbridge Presbyterian, Stockbridge, GA) and as a Ruling Elder (ordained at Ray-Thomas Memorial Presbyterian, Marietta, GA). While serving as a Ruling Elder in Cherokee Presbytery, Susan was a Commissioned Lay Pastor, served  on the Committee on Ministry (one year as Chair), was Moderator of Presbytery 1987-88, and was a Ruling Elder Commissioner to the 1994 General Assembly. Susan's involvement in the Presbytery of Greater Atlanta as a member minister for the past 16 years has included chairing the Committee on Ministry and serving as Clerk of the Permanent Judicial Commission. In the years leading to her coming to Faith, Susan served as a Senior Pastor and head of staff for churches in transition.

 

As Pastoral Associate for Pastoral Care and Mission & Outreach, Susan shares in preaching and worship leadership and as pastoral support to the Congregational Care Planning Team and the individual Shepherds. additionally, she provides primary pastoral care response to the needs of members and friends of the congregation and serves as staff liaison and resource to the Mission and Outreach Planning Team. 




Kathy Wills, Director of Music

  

Kathy Wills is a native of Charleston, SC, where she completed a BA degree in Piano, Voice, and Organ Performance. She proceeded to the University of South Carolina where she completed an MM degree in Piano Pedagogy (the science of teaching) with additional studies in Harpsichord. Since then, she has taught music to all ages and levels of students and has produced many professional musicians. She has been very active as officer and judge for the Music Teachers National Association, the Georgia Music Teachers Association, the National Federation of Music Clubs, and the National Guild of Piano Teachers. Her sacred music calling has led her to serve in churches of many denominations, especially Presbyterian (USA and PCA), United Methodist, Episcopalian, Baptist, as well as the Beth Elohim Jewish Synagogue in Charleston. While living in Atlanta, GA, she was Concert Artist and Factory Representative for the Kawai America Piano Corporation.

She currently enjoys the country life in the mountains West of Murphy, NC with her horses, dogs, cats, and whatever else shows up hungry. She teaches piano and voice at Faith Presbyterian and at her studio in downtown Murphy. She is also a 2nd degree Black Belt in Taekwondo and the Executive Director of the Christian Martial Arts Center in Murphy where self defense is taught in a nurturing Christian environment.
